Optimize Your LinkedIn Profile First

Before focusing on growth, optimize your profile for credibility and conversions.

Use a Professional Profile Photo

A clear and professional image improves trust and visibility.

Write a Strong Headline

Your headline should explain:

  • What you do

  • Who you help

  • The value you provide

Avoid generic titles like “Founder” or “Coach.”

Create an Engaging About Section

Focus on storytelling, achievements, expertise, and client transformation.

Add Social Proof

Include:

  • Testimonials

  • Case studies

  • Portfolio links

  • Featured posts

Consistency Is Key

LinkedIn rewards consistent activity.

Recommended posting frequency:

  • 3–5 posts per week

  • Daily engagement with others

  • Regular comment participation

Growth compounds over time through consistent visibility.

Common LinkedIn Growth Mistakes

Posting Without Strategy

Random content rarely produces consistent growth.

Over-Selling

Constant sales pitches reduce audience trust and engagement.

Ignoring Engagement

LinkedIn growth depends heavily on conversations and relationship building.

Inconsistent Activity

Long posting gaps reduce visibility and audience momentum.
